Output e94d6aaa34a7f33a1c3c62a648e776495ccd2f0998b14233d3a1aa72974121e1:15

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c6ee491760a7b5365b21e328ac4b37328fba4c OP_EQUAL
address
353UZQPnXRX2kqsYgjoPAw2TzGvU7ZaqKM
transaction
e94d6aaa34a7f33a1c3c62a648e776495ccd2f0998b14233d3a1aa72974121e1
confirmations
77108
spent
true